In 1883 I communicated a paper* to the Royal Society, in which I described the occurrence of a pigment closely resembling vegetable chlorophyll in the so-called liver of Invertebrates, and in 1885 a further contribution in continuation of the same subject, which was published in the ‘ Philosophical Transactions’ (Part I, 1886).
